Abstract :
Multiprocessor system-on-chip designers face challenges during prototyping, when there is a real need for methods and tools that can easily map applications onto different architectures without tedious redesigning. Such methods and tools must also ensure rapid validation. A new MPSoC prototyping and validation approach uses the Posix 1003 1.C API standard and a reconfigurable multiprocessor hardware platform for fast prototyping of Posix-based applications.
